The CEO of the Korle-Bu Teaching hospital has been out of his office for over a week after testing positive for Covid-19.
Since Dr Daniel Asare's left his post, Dr Ali Samba, the Medical Director of the country's number one referral hospital has been acting.
Joy News sources say three other persons in the CEO's office have gone into self-isolation.
Dr Daniel Asare joins the tall list of medical practitioners in the country who have contracted the virus.
Kweku Agyeman Manu, the Health Minister as well as the CEO of the National Health Insurance Authority (NHIA), Lydia Dsane-Selby have also tested positive for the novel virus.
On Wednesday, the Ghana Association of Medical Laboratory Scientists (GAMLS) revealed that one of its members has died of the novel coronavirus.
The medical laboratory professional was with the Weija-Gbawe Municipal Hospital where he worked as a sample collector for Covid-19 testing.
Last Friday, the deceased was rushed to the Komfo Anokye Teaching Hospital (KATH) Emergency Unit after having trouble in breathing and died on Monday.
